Two solid discs of radii r and 2r roll from the top of an inclined plane without slipping. Then

Options

(a) The bigger disc will reach the horizontal level first
(b) The smaller disc will reach the horizontal level first
(c) The time difference of reaching of the discs at the horizontal level will depend on the inclination of the plane
(d) Both the discs will reach at the same time

Correct Answer:

Both the discs will reach at the same time
